Ross King makes Strictly Come Dancing debut as glamorous girlfriend watches from the audience

Ross King, 63, left Strictly Come Dancing fans speechless on Saturday night when his glamorous new girlfriend was seen in the audience as he made his BBC debut on the ballroom show. He performed the cha-cha-cha with professional partner Jowita to Katy Perry's California Gurls and earned 10 points out of 40, a modest start for a first performance on the long-running competition.

After the routine, King paid tribute to Bridget, saying she had flown more than 5,000 miles to be in the audience. He added, "It's so lovely that my girlfriend Bridget flew over 5,000 miles to come watch. I said to her, 'You have to come because there might not be many of these'."

Cameras then captured Bridget in a strapless black dress as she watched King alongside his sister Elaine, prompting a flurry of reaction from Strictly fans online. King, originally from Scotland, has long since established a life in Los Angeles. He left the United Kingdom in 2000 to become GMTV's showbiz correspondent, a role he held until 2010. He later took on a range of presenting assignments, including a stint as a weather presenter for KTLA after winning a competition that launched his career on the channel. His film credits include The Day After Tomorrow, Half Past Dead, Do It For Uncle Manny, Trust Me, Young Hercules and Who’s Your Caddy, among others.
